List of few S P JAIN BBA Admission Test Questions is given below:

1. There are six people T, U, V, W, X and Y. Two of them are from England, one is from America, one is from Australia, one is from Libya and one is from India. T who is from Libya, is married to W. X is not from England. None of the females is from Australia or America or Libya. V who is from America is married to Y who is from India. Among the six people they are two married couples. What is the gender of W and to which country does he/she belong?
(A) W is a male from Australia
(B) W is a female from Australia
(C) W is a male from England
(D) W is a female from England

2. A cube has a side of 4 cm. The cube is painted red on all six sides. This cube is then cut into 125 smaller cubes. How many of these smaller cubes will have only one of their sides painted red
(A) 27 cubes
(B) 54 cubes
(C) 81 cubes
(D) 108 cubes

3. Sheila is hosting a party at our house. All guests are going to be seated in chairs around a large perfectly circular table at a distance of 3 meter from each of its adjacent chairs. All the guests arrive at a separate time and each guest takes a chair to the immediate left of the last guest who arrived. If Rani who was the sixth guest to arrive is sitting diametrically opposite to Sunita who was the fourteenth guest to arrive how many people were sitting at the round table
(A) 12
(B) 16
(C) 18
(D) 20

4
4. A book seller has to arrange five magazines on his newsstand from left to right. The five magazines are America Daily, Music and More, Science, Readers Digest and Sports Illustrated. America Daily and Science cannot be placed next to each other as they are published by competing publishers. The sports illustrated and the Readers Digest must always be next to each other as there is a special discount if both the magazines are bought together. It is known that the Music and More Magazine is not kept next to the Readers Digest. If the Sports Illustrated is kept second from left and America Daily is kept second from right then which magazine is kept on the extreme right?
(A) Readers Digest
(B) Science
(C) Music and More
(D) Cannot be determined

5. A,B.C,D,E,F,G,H,I, and J are students at ABC school. A beach volleyball tournament is coming up and a team of three students must be selected based on the following conditions:
If a team includes A, then it must also include B, and vice versa.
If a team includes one among H, I, and J, then it must also include the other two.
A team must include exactly one among E, G, and H.
A team must include either C or F, but not both.
B and D cannot be members of the same volleyball team.
B and I cannot be members of the same volleyball team.
Which of the following students cannot be selected for the team?
(A) F
(B) B
(C) C
(D) D

NUMERACY (6Q x 3 = 18 marks. Negative marking – 1 mark)

1. If 2x + 4y = -2 and y - x = -8, then x =? (A) -5 (B) -3 (C) 3 (D) 5 (E) None of the above

2. If x2 - 4x = 5, then which of the following is not a possible value of x? I. 5 II. 1 III. 0 (A) I and II only (B) II and III only (C) I and III only (D) All of I, II and III (E) None of the above E D C B A

3. In the above diagram (not drawn to scale) CD is parallel to AB. Angle CDE measures 90 degrees. BD=DE, CD=6cm and DE =8cm.What is the length of AE?
(A) 10cm (B) 12 cm (C) 16 cm (D) 20 cm (E) None of the above

4. If -1 < 2-x < 1, then
(A) -3 < x (B) x > -1 (C) 1 < x < 3 (D) -3 < x < -1

GENERAL AWARENESS(8Q x 2 = 16 marks. Negative marking – 0.5 mark)

1. Which of the following nations has never won the Football World Cup?
(A) Uruguay (B) England (C) France (D) Netherlands

2. Who is the current Prime Minister of Australia?
(A) Kevin Rudd (B) Julia Gillard (C) David Cameron (D) John Howard

3. Which company out of the following companies was cofounded by Jack Dorsey, Evan Williams and Biz Stone?
(A) Facebook (B) Ebay (C) Google (D) Twitter

4. Which of the following novels was not written by Charles Dickens?
(A) The Adventures of Oliver Twist (B) War of the Worlds (C) David Copperfield (D) A Tale of Two Cities

5. Who was the President of the United States of America during the Cuban Missile Crisis?
(A) John F. Kennedy (B) Abraham Lincoln (C) Theodore Roosevelt (D) Jimmy Carter

6. Which of the following animals does not lays eggs? (
A) Pigeon (B) Ostrich (C) Penguin (D) Bat

7. Which actor portrayed the role of Indiana Jones in the Indian Jones movie series?
(A) Tom Hanks (B) Harrisson Ford (C) Al Pacino (D) Robert De Niro

8. What is the national game of China?
(A) Cricket (B) Table Tennis (C) Ball (D) Hockey
